UNION HS is a Title I public high school that is part of the UNION school district, located in Tulsa, OK with about 3,448 students offering grade levels from 10th Grade to 12th Grade. Student demographics can be found below. A Title I school provides supplemental financial assistance to school districts for children from low-income families. Its purpose is to provide all children significant opportunity to receive a fair, equitable, and high-quality education. With about 149 teachers, UNION HS has a student/teacher ratio of about 23:1. The national average for public schools is about 15:1. A lower student/teacher ratio is a key factor that determines how much a teacher can devote his/her time to each individual student thus improving, or reducing (in the event of a higher student/teacher ratio) the attention each student is given for their educational needs.
Union High School, located in Tulsa, Oklahoma, is the flagship secondary institution of the Union Public Schools district. Serving a large and diverse student body, the school is well-regarded for its extensive academic offerings, which include a robust selection of Advanced Placement (AP) courses, concurrent college enrollment opportunities, and specialized career-tech programs. The school is widely recognized for its commitment to providing a comprehensive educational experience that prepares students for both higher education and the modern workforce.
Beyond the classroom, Union High School is famous for its vibrant campus culture and highly competitive extracurricular programs. The school boasts a storied tradition in athletics and fine arts, with its nationally recognized marching band and championship-level sports teams serving as major points of school and community pride. With a strong emphasis on student engagement, inclusive programs, and a dedication to academic excellence, Union High School remains a focal point of the Tulsa community, fostering an environment designed to support the success of its diverse student population.
